BOYS’ SOCCER

Desert Mirage 4, Sage Hill 0

THERMAL — The Lightning allowed the most goals in a game this season in their wild-card loss of the CIF Southern Section Division VI playoffs Wednesday.

Sage Hill had never allowed more than two goals this year. The Lightning had also been unbeaten in its previous six matches before facing Desert Mirage.

Sage Hill ends its season at 7-7-4.

SURFING

Newport Harbor 85,

Edison 83

NEWPORT BEACH — The Sailors won the last two heats by one point to score the nonleague victory over Edison (7-2) at 56th Street Wednesday morning.

The two teams were tied for six heats, but the Sailors (9-1) won the last two heats.

Newport Harbor won five of eight heats and three of the four events.

The boys’ shortboard squad won, 44-40, after taking three of the four heats. Victor Done had the top average wave score with 6.8. Eric Heimstaedt, Cameron Clark and Mark Contreras all took second in their heats.

Bobby Okvist, Tyler Tarlow and Jared Cassidy were third.

Newport Harbor’s bodyboard squad won, 11-10. Yuji Kanbayashi took second place and Joe Suzuki placed third.

The boys’ longboard squad won ,11-10, as Robert Guy took second and Andy Delorme was third.

The Sailors’ girls’ shortboard squad lost, 11-10, its first loss of the season. Kaleigh Gilchrist finished in first place for the eighth time this season.

Hailey Sandberg also took first in the longboard, but the girls still lost, 12-9.

Newport Harbor will face Edison again March 5 at River Jetty North in Huntington Beach.
